The drawer aside was set to `bg-white/50 dark:bg-white/[0.01]` with a `backdrop-blur-3xl`. In light mode this rendered as a 50%-transparent white panel over the page underneath, which made every item read "grayed-out" through the blur. In dark mode the 0.01 white was so faint that the panel was effectively transparent. Switch to `bg-sidebar` — the opaque sidebar token already used by the desktop navbar — and drop the backdrop blur (pointless without the transparency). Items now sit on a solid surface with normal contrast in both themes.

Vercel Deployment with Git LFS
Docs assets are tracked with Git LFS. To ensure production builds always receive
real asset bytes (not pointer files), deploy docs through GitHub Actions using
.github/workflows/deploy_docs_vercel.yml.
Required GitHub repository secrets:
VERCEL_TOKENVERCEL_ORG_IDVERCEL_PROJECT_ID_DOCS
